É um bom curso se você já tiver algum conhecimento prévio. Para iniciantes, alguns conceitos podem ser um pouco desafiadores, mas a estrutura é lógica.
Build an eCommerce Website with Java Servlets, JSP, and Hibernate
Learn full-stack Java development by building a complete online bookstore using Servlets, JSP, and Hibernate database mapping.
Sobre este curso
Building web applications requires a solid understanding of how backend logic, databases, and frontends interact. This course guides you through the process of developing a fully functional online bookstore using Java's core web technologies.
You will transition from writing basic Java code to designing a complete, database-driven web application. By working through the architecture of an eCommerce site, you will gain practical experience with server-side logic, dynamic page rendering, and object-relational mapping.
What you'll learn:
- Understand the foundational concepts of Java Servlets, JSP, and HTTP request-response lifecycles.
- Configure Hibernate to map Java classes to relational database tables seamlessly.
- Build core eCommerce features including a shopping cart, user authentication, and product catalog management.
- Apply modern Java features like Records for clean data transfer and modern Maven project structures.
- Implement secure coding practices such as password hashing and SQL injection prevention.
- Design a dynamic frontend using JSP standard tag libraries (JSTL) and expression language.
The course starts with fundamental web concepts and database setup before moving step-by-step through backend development, database integration, and frontend presentation. This text-based course is designed for beginner Java programmers who want to step into full-stack web development, requiring no prior experience with web frameworks.
Start building your first full-stack Java web application today.
O que você vai receber
-
📜
Certificado de conclusão
Adicione ao seu perfil do LinkedIn -
🎧
Versão em áudio incluída
Estude em qualquer lugar, sem tela -
♾️
Acesso vitalício
Volte quando quiser, sem expirar -
📱
Celular ou computador
Funciona em qualquer dispositivo -
💸
Reembolso em 30 dias
Sem perguntas -
⚡
Curto e focado
38 min de conteúdo prático
Avaliações (1)
Outros também fizeram
Aprenda a criar, organizar e manter aplicativos web estruturados de página única usando a arquitetura AngularJS e padrões de design modular.
$4.99$9.99
Saiba como gerenciar fluxos de dados assíncronos, lidar com eventos complexos e escrever código JavaScript limpo e reativo usando observadores RxJS e operadores modernos.
$4.99$9.99
Crie um aplicativo web robusto e em tempo real do zero usando Angular, estilizando-o com Material Design, gerenciando o estado com NgRx e integrando serviços de banco de dados do Firebase.
$4.99$9.99
Domine os fundamentos da programação web usando o Go para criar servidores de alto desempenho e aplicativos web escaláveis por meio de instruções claras e escritas.
$4.99$9.99
Perguntas frequentes
O que preciso para fazer este curso? +
Só um celular ou computador com internet. Sem instalações nem hardware especial.
Como faço para pagar? +
Cartão via Stripe ou criptomoeda. Não guardamos dados do cartão — o Stripe processa com segurança.
Posso pedir reembolso? +
Sim — reembolso integral em 30 dias, sem perguntas.
Por quanto tempo terei acesso? +
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.
Vou receber um certificado? +
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.
Feito para profissionais em
Tecnologia
Design
Finanças
Marketing
Saúde
Educação
Hotelaria
Indústria